Predicting Gurgaon's Climate

Gurgaon experiences distinct climatic fluctuations. The city generally enjoys warm summers from March to June, with temperatures often surpassing over 100°F. Monsoon season arrives around July, bringing much-needed rainfall get more info and offering a soothing break from the heat. Winters set in in November and last until February, with mild temperatures and occasional spells of fog.

A noticeable trend in recent years is the escalation of extreme weather events in Gurgaon. Heat waves are becoming happening increasingly, with prolonged periods of sweltering heat, while the monsoon season presents unpredictable patterns.
